Use buttons
To take a screenshot is to use the buttons. You can simultaneously press the Volume Down and Power buttons and keep them pressed until the screenshot is saved. You can use this method to make a scrolling screenshot.

Google Assistant
The slothful option is to use Google Assistant. Just say OK Google and then Take a screenshot. The phone will do everything for you.

Where are screenshots stored? If you can't find the screenshots you made, don't despair. The phone can save screenshots to different folders. Again, it all depends on custom shells. A pure Android throws pictures into the gallery (DCIM). Other shells can save screenshots to a different folder for your convenience.
How do I share my screenshots? Depending on the Android version and the custom shell, sending screenshots may differ. In lastest versions of Android (9 or 10), the smart menu will arise after you take a screenshot instantly. There you need to choose the appropriate icon for sharing.
